from Amazon careersThe Brazil Inbound team (BRIO) is responsible for ensuring the efficient flow of products from suppliers to distribution centers, maintaining appropriate inventory levels to meet customer demand. Within BRIO, the Sub Same Day pillar represents one of our most strategic and customer-centric initiatives, requiring intelligent inventory positioning and agile replenishment strategies. The Sub Same Day Replenishment Manager position will own the end-to-end management of inventory placement and inbound strategies to support the ultra-fast delivery commitments of our Sub Same Day business. The ideal candidate is passionate about leveraging data to drive strategic inventory decisions and implement scalable solutions that directly impact customer experience and operational performance. They have a strong track record of delivering results in a cross-functional environment, leading through influence and data-driven insights, and thrive in a fast-paced setting working with large datasets, solving complex problems related to inventory placement, network capacity, and inbound flow optimization, while building strong partnerships with transportation, warehouse operations, and network planning teams. Key job responsibilities As a Sub Same Day Replenishment Manager, you will own the end-to-end strategy and execution of inventory placement and inbound operations for the Sub Same Day network.
